MATH 200-01-02: Course Goals
Instructor: Misha Shvartsman 

General Goals:
1. Gaining factual knowledge (terminology and methods)
2. Learning to apply course material (problem solving)

Subject Goals:

1. To learn and to understand how geometry of three-dimensional space can be described using vectors and vector functions
2. To develop skills in evaluating limits, derivatives, extremal properties and integrals for the functions of several variables;
that portion will extend ideas you learned in the calculus of one variable (covered in MATH 113 and MATH 114) to a multivariable setting.
3. To learn and to understand concepts and methods of vector analysis

4. To learn and to understand concepts of line and surface integrals in the context of vector analysis
5. To learn and to understand concepts of curl and divergence 
6. To learn and to understand Green's, Divergence and Stokes' Theorems
